Founders, Eric & Patty Woller, are both very creative and hold a strong eye for detail. They have taken cake decorating to new heights in the Central Illinois area. Eric has a strong background in the arts and has been working as a scenic carpenter for the theme park industry as well as fabricating custom furniture and murals for children's rooms. Patty has worked as a hospitality designer working on hotel and restaurant projects across the country. With the fusion of artistic and creative skills, nothing is considered out of limits. "We will do our best to accommodate any outrageous sugar art request!" With the creation of MeMe’s Treat Boutique, the sugar artists are offering Central Illinois exquisite taste and original works of sugar art for any occasion.
